Grilled Skewers with Global Influence
Skewered chicken dishes showcase flavor from around the world. Vendors draw inspiration from Japanese yakitori, Mediterranean souvlaki, and Caribbean jerk styles. Each version highlights marinades rich with herbs, citrus, or spices. The result is smoky, tender meat that fits perfectly with outdoor cooking setups.
Grilled skewers are easy to prepare and portion, which helps control costs. They also suit gluten-free and low-carb diets, widening the appeal for event guests. Colorful vegetable pairings such as peppers and onions, add freshness and visual appeal. Every skewer tells a story of fusion and creativity that defines modern street cuisine.
Chicken Bowls That Blend Comfort and Balance
Chicken bowls offer a hearty yet customizable option that guests enjoy building themselves. Vendors can mix rice, quinoa, or salad bases with seasoned chicken, sauces, and vegetables. These combinations give a healthy edge while maintaining rich flavor. Bowls work well for quick service since ingredients are prepped in batches.
Guests appreciate the flexibility to choose toppings that suit personal preferences. Spicy chipotle sauce or cool ranch dressing adds personality to every portion. Vendors benefit from efficient assembly and easier waste management. This balance between nutrition and convenience makes bowls a go-to favorite at mobile food events.
Wings That Keep Crowds Coming Back
No discussion of signature chicken dishes would be complete without wings. Food trucks serve them in flavors ranging from classic buffalo to tangy lemon pepper. Their shareable nature fits social gatherings perfectly, encouraging guests to sample and compare sauces. Each bite brings the right mix of crunch, heat, and satisfaction.
To keep operations smooth, vendors often focus on three or four key flavors. This strategy simplifies preparation while ensuring consistent quality. Many trucks feature dipping sauces or combo platters to add variety. The crowd-pleasing effect of wings never fades; they’re always the highlight of a good food truck lineup.
